Value of (x-y)^4
Source: Beat The GMAT — Data Sufficiency |
The answer is C.
1. The product of X & Y is 7. Not sufficient. As X=0.01, Y=700 or X=0.1, Y=70 producing different results for (X-Y)^4
2. X & Y are integers; Not sufficient to arrive at single results for (X-Y)^4.
Combinging both -
XY = 7
=> X = 1, Y =7
=> X = -1, Y = -7
=> X = 7, Y = 1
=> X = -7, Y = -1
All result into 6^4.
Thus answer is C.
